                        Hey, I'm not great at explaining things, but I did get it to work so I can try. :)
                        You have to put xnb_node in the same folder as the game. For example, I have the game on steam, so the file location is Local Disk (C:)/Program Files (x86)/Steam/steamapps/common/Stardew Valley. That folder should also hold your Content and Mods folders.
                        The only way I've gotten the toolkit to work is on the desktop. With the xnb_node in that folder, and the toolkit on the desktop it should load the full version.
                        In the toolkit load your save file (found appdata/roaming/stardewvalley/saves) and that should show you all of the animals you own in your game. Next make sure to load farm animals to be sure you got all of the animals in your game. The next tab is where you add animals. It's fairly self explanatory. The last tab is where you manage the animals that are in your game, in case you want to delete some. Once you've added animals, go back to the first tab and change the animals you own into the new breeds, then save the game.
                        Hopefully that makes sense, good luck :)
